— The test sieve was 75 μm and the Hardgrove index was determined using the following formula: (3) H o = 13 + 6.93 m H where m H is the weight of the ground product passing 75 μm. According to the Csőke et al. (2003) formula, the Bond work index can be calculated from Hardgrove number as follows: (4) W B H = 468 H 0.82 o

The Hardgrove Grindability Index (HGI) is a measure of coal's resistance to crushing. Grinding studies, and the resulting HGI, allow many different types of coal users to evaluate how coals will perform in their mills, allowing them to estimate grinding power requirements and throughput capacities.

The Hardgrove Grindability Index Primary Reference Material (HGI-RM) is a sample of coal used to calibrate instruments that are designed to determine the ease with which coal can be pulverized. The HGI value provides information for determining grinding power consumption and pulverizer capacities. The HGI-RM is prepared in a series of steps …

— Hardgrove's coefficient tester grindability is shown in Fig. 2. Hardgrove's coefficient tester HGI consists of a fixed grinding bowl made of hardened steel with a horizontal track on which eight steel balls with a diameter of 25.4 mm. The balls are set in a motion upper-pressure ring that rotates at a speed of 19–21 min −1. The top pressure ...
